The Role:
Full-Time Emergency Medicine Lead
APP/APRN
Based at Cheyenne Regional Medical Center , this role is ideal for APPs who thrive in a fast-paced, high-acuity ED and want to grow long-term with a tight-knit, collaborative team.
What You'll Do:
Provide care for patients across all ESI levels in a 42-bed Emergency Department while maintaining a patient-centered care environment Serve as the professional and operational liaison for APPs practicing in the Emergency Department. Partner closely with the Site Medical Director, nursing leadership, and hospital administration to align APP practice with hospital policies, quality standards, and operational goals. Develop, manage, and evaluate operational initiatives with measurable outcomes related to APP performance, patient flow, and care delivery. Maintain oversight of APP scope of practice, regulatory compliance, and professional standards. Participate in interdisciplinary rounds and departmental leadership discussions. Perform advanced procedures within scope, including but not limited to suturing, splinting, intubation, central lines, chest tubes, lumbar punctures, procedural sedation, FAST exams, and other ED procedures. Maintain accurate, timely, and compliant documentation. Leadership & Administrative Responsibilities Provide direct leadership, supervision, mentorship, and performance evaluation of site APPs. Conduct and document APP performance reviews, addressing clinical quality, professionalism, documentation, patient relations, and overall effectiveness. Review Emergency Department charts for documentation quality, appropriateness of care, testing, and billing for APP services. Participate in peer review activities and ensure compliance with quality and safety standards. Remain actively involved in addressing and resolving patient complaints and grievances related to APP care. Assist the Medical Director with workforce planning, FTE analysis, and scheduling oversight. Oversee and validate APP schedules with the goal of publishing schedules at least 90 days in advance. Facilitate APP meetings and effectively communicate data, expectations, and performance outcomes. Support recruitment, onboarding, retention, and professional development of APPs, including participation in interviews and site tours. The Hospital:
Cheyenne Regional Medical Center Founded in 1867 as a frontier "tent" hospital, Cheyenne Regional Medical Center has deep roots in the community. Today, it is a 222-bed acute care hospital and Level II Trauma Center , continuing its pioneering spirit of compassionate, world-class care.
ED Highlights:
Patient volume: ~1.3-1.5 patients/hr.
Capacity:
42 beds.
EMR:
Epic. 24/7 transfer center
Support Services:
ICU(17-bed), cath lab, stroke and chest pain center Why Cheyenne? Cheyenne blends small-town charm with big-city access.
